掌握这个【公式】,成为 ChatGPT 提问高手

在人工智能大行其道的时代,与大言语模型进行有用交流的才干变得越来越重要。你或许发现有些 ChatGPT 的答复只是泛泛而谈,而有些则深化而透彻。其实它答复的质量很大程度上取决你的指令。精心设计一个深思熟虑、结构出色的指令将大大提高 ChatGPT 输出的质量。

本文将高质量的指令总结成一个公式:抱负的指令 = 使命 + 布景 + 典范 + 人物 + 格局 + 口气。虽然这公式里的六个元素都很有价值,但它们的重要性时有层次的,且听我娓娓道来。

掌握这个【公式】,成为 ChatGPT 提问高手

使命 (Task)

要让 ChatGPT 成为我们的助手,首先要给它指定一个清晰的使命。指定使命是这个万能公式的核心,它像一个指南针,引导 ChatGPT 朝着既定目标前进。指定一个清晰而清晰的使命,能够让 ChatGPT 从庞大的知识库中调取最相关的知识,生成高质量的呼应。

下面是一些给 ChatGPT 指定使命的主张:

  • 用最直接的口气写一个疑问句或陈述句,标明你想要什么。例如,你能够指定 “罗列几个改进睡觉的办法”,而不是 “你知道怎么改进睡觉吗”。
  • 以“解说 (Explain)”、“比较 (Compare)”、“总结 (Summarize)”、“写 (Write)”、“供给 (Provide)”、“罗列 (List)” 等动作词开端你的指令。这些词界说了 ChatGPT 的呼应类型。
  • 要有结构化思想,让 ChatGPT 生成清晰的答复。例如,方才的问题能够优化为 “罗列5个改进睡觉的最佳办法及优劣势”。
  • 使命越具体越好,防止模糊和歧义。例如,“列出有史以来最有影响力的5本书” 这个使命中的影响力怎么界定,是文化上,政治上还是技能上?
  • 当提出多个问题时,将它们按逻辑分成不同的部分,每个问题另起一行。
  • 恰当加一些限制条件,能够让答复更精准。比方当你问一些技能性问题时,你能够让 ChatGPT 针对不懂技能的人群来答复。

使命布景 (Context)

供给相关的使命布景关于写一个有用的指令至关重要。之所以如此,由于以下原因:

  • 怎么没有恰当的使命布景,ChatGPT 能够用不同的方式解说你的指令,终究导致一些过于宽泛,模棱两可的无效答复。
  • 依据你的实际情况供给具体的布景信息能够让 ChatGPT 生成的答复愈加契合你的需求。
  • 复杂的使命通常需求深化了解使命的细节,供给具体的使命布景让 ChatGPT 更善于处理复杂的使命。

假如不供给布景信息,ChatGPT 乃至都无法完成某些使命。例如我在之前的文章中,让 ChatGPT 为我生成 Midjourney 的指令。

Midjourney V5 + ChatGPT 王炸组合: 两种办法让ChatGPT为你写Midjourney提示词

可是 ChatGPT 的练习数据在2021年9月之前,它乃至都不知道 Midjourney 是什么。我只要在指令中告知它 Midjourney 是什么,怎么写指令等等,才把它练习成一个 Midjourney 指令生成器。

在供给上下文时,你能够答复这样一些问题:

  • 你是谁?你是学生、教师、工程师、营销人员吗?界说自己的人物能够为 ChatGPT 供给一个视角。
  • 你从事什么范畴?学术、商业、技能?这能够让 ChatGPT 的答复愈加契合范畴内的规范、共识等等。
  • 你目前的知识水平怎么?你是有关该问题的初学者还是专家?这样能够调整 ChatGPT 答复的深度以及术语。
  • 你有过什么经历?你现已把握了有关该问题的哪些信息或许技能,这样能够防止 ChatGPT 的答复包括你现已把握的内容。

答复了这些问题,你能够将使命布景纳入 ChatGPT 指令,例如:

作为一名正在编撰机器学习课程研讨论文的计算机科学专业的学生,我拥有神经网络的基础知识和一些 Python 编程的经历。我需求总结监督式、无监督式和强化学习算法之间的首要差异。请用三个简略的阶段对每种办法进行概述。

典范 (Exemplars)

假如或许的话,给 ChatGPT 一些示例作为参阅,这样能够让 ChatGPT 愈加清楚你的目的。有时候,不管你把指令写的多么具体,假如没有示例的话,你还是没有办法让 ChatGPT 生成契合你要求的答复。

给一些示例的话,ChatGPT 就能够学习示例中的语句结构、格局、风格、知识的深度,理解其间一些你需求大量言语才干描绘的细节,从而生成高质量的答案。

比方当你要写一个产品描绘时,你能够找一些竞争对手的优秀案例作为示例,ChatGPT 就会向你的竞争对手学习并把握产品描绘的写法。当你要写简历时,能够找一些优秀的简历模板。

有了高质量的示例,你乃至还能够逆向生成一个高质量的指令模板,想深化了解的话能够看看我之前的一篇文章:

用 ChatGPT 逆向生成 Prompt,打造自己的指令模板

人物 (Persona)

为 ChatGPT 界说一个人物是一个非常重要的技能,由此乃至诞生了某些现已界说好人物的 AI 产品,比方 Character.AI。界说人物有以下好处:

  • 能够让你和 ChatGPT 的对话愈加天然和情境话,就像和真人而不是一个通用的机器人谈天相同
  • 能够让 ChatGPT 依据设定的人物生成愈加个性化,契合人物风格的答复。比方让 ChatGPT 扮演卓别林跟你谈天。
  • 能够使 ChatGPT 的答复契合其设定人物的口气、词汇、语句结构和风格。比方让 ChatGPT 扮演某位诗人,它就会生成相应风格的文本。
  • 能够把 ChatGPT 的答复限定在特定范畴,而不是生成一个通用的,泛泛而谈的答复。比方医师、律师等专业范畴。
  • 能够提高 ChatGPT 答复的准确性。比方你要解决数学问题时,让 ChatGPT 扮演“出色数学家”的人物,与一般指令比较,能够得到更准确的成果。

虽然指定人物很重要,但是也不需求乱用。在某些情况下,大可不必指定人物,比方:

  • 你只想提交一个简略的问题或使命,并不需求特定范畴的助理身份
  • 你需求 ChatGPT 从很多角度或范畴答复问题,分配人物会限定 ChatGPT 答复的规模
  • 你现已供给了足够多的使命布景,乃至还给了很多典范,这时候再分配人物会显得剩余乃至起反作用
  • 你想指定的人物缺少答复你问题的专业知识

格局 (Format)

在指令里指定相应的格局也非常重要,但不是必须项。

但是,某些格局关于某些使命能够起到决定性的作用。比方我在之前的文章中介绍了怎么生成精巧的 PDF , 其间就用到了 HTML 格局。

所有人都能够用ChatGPT主动生成「精巧」的PDF啦

最常用的便是给 ChatGPT 指定一个输出量。有时候你时间有限,只是需求一个简略的答复,但 ChatGPT 或许会生成长篇大论,尤其是 GPT-4 。你或许要指定生成几个阶段,几个语句,几个单词,乃至几个字符。或许用一些相对尺度,如“扼要”、“具体”、“全面”等。

ChatGPT 答复的结构也很重要,虽然 ChatGPT 默许主动就会生成 Markdown 格局,其间现已包括一些大标题小标题,项目符号 (Bullet Points),但有时并不会默许生成,当你对格局有要求时,无妨指定一下。

表格也是经常需求被指定的格局,它能够非常直观的呈现数据。你还能够把表格输出为 Excel 或许 CSV。

4种办法导出ChatGPT表格为CSV或Excel, 总有一种适宜你

采用适宜的办法,你还能够让 ChatGPT 生成思想导图,和其他类型的图表。

怎么用 ChatGPT 或 Claude 创建高颜值的思想导图

ChatGPT两种方式无代码生成流程图甘特图等图表

ChatGPT 还能够生成许多格局,例如 JSON, CSV, XML, YAML, SVG, Checklist 等等。

口气 (Tone)

为 ChatGPT 界说口气也是一个可选项,比方当你界说了某些人物时,就现已界说了契合人物身份的口气。或许当你给了一些典范时,典范里面现已包括了一些特定的口气。

但是,它在某些情境下很重要,比方:

  • 当你的内容针对消费者时,你需求 ChatGPT 采用对话式的、友爱的口气
  • 当你供给技能指导时,需求威望的专家口气
  • 当 ChatGPT 的内容会成为工作场所的文件的一部分时,你需求正式而专业的口气
  • 当你用 ChatGPT 写论文时,需求客观的学术口气
  • 当你用 ChatGPT 写邮件或许回复即时信息时,怜惜的口气能够安慰人,热心的口气能够激烈人

下面是指定口气的一些主张:

  • 指定口气之前,考虑下内容会展现给的目标受众,它们的偏好,文化布景和期望是什么
  • 尽或许具体,比方当你要指定正式的口气时,能够加上“不要运用俚语或习语”
  • 指定口气时你也能够给 ChatGPT 一些典范,比方运用脱口秀的口气或许 TED 的谈话风格。
  • 假如你不确定运用什么口气,能够让 ChatGPT 给你主张

总结

ChatGPT 和指令的联系就像土壤和种子。只要高质量的种子才干长出高质量的植物。假如你追求答复的质量,无妨考虑精心设计一个指令。这个进程也会大大提高对 ChatGPT 的发问才干。

假如时间有限,想要迅速优化你原有的指令,无妨试试我的快速解决方案

瞬间优化 ChatGPT 指令的 2 种办法

分享结束,感谢阅览 欢迎点赞,收藏,评论

更多免费原创教程,重视公众号:我的AI力气